    The fallout from the schedule release demands a deep dive into how the Raiders can manage the 2025 campaign. The Las Vegas Raiders' 2025 schedule has officially been released. The Silver and Black have a heavy burden on their hands, as they will battle both Super Bowl participants and the NFC runner-up on the road. Fortunately, the team is playing a fourth-place schedule, which means they will face off against a number of teams in a similar situation.

    Sherrone Moore will have some difficult decisions to keep and pay a handful of coaches that will be in high demand very soon. With a year under their belts and a win over the National Champions, Michigan's coaches are becoming quite the prize within the coaching ranks. Another year of similar success, and some of these coaches will be getting non-stop calls about new opportunities at different stops. Here are four names that will be due more money if Michigan football keeps winning at a rapid pace.
